A Robot Vacuum Cleaner Review

A robot vacuum may help you achieve more by removing items from your to-do list. But it's important to remember that robots aren't a complete replacement for a regular, full-size vacuum.

smart-robot-vacuum-saving-mom-and-kid-from-tedious-2023-11-27-05-00-38-utc-min-jpg-original.jpgThe dustbins on robot vacuums are smaller than those in traditional vacs, which means they have to be cleaned more frequently. Look for models that have self-emptying docking stations to eliminate the need for manually emptying.

1. It's simple to use

Robots may not be capable of achieving the capabilities of a full-size vacuum cleaner, but they still do a good job in cleaning any kind of particle, from fine ones like sand and baking soda, to more substantial debris such as screws made of metal and pet hair. Because they are smaller than most vacuums, they are able to fit under couches and ottomans that are low enough to reach crevices where most models can't.

The majority of robots employ a variety of sensors to track and navigate around the floor. Common ones include infrared, laser and camera-based systems. These sensors are paired with mapping algorithms to create an accurate map of your house that guides the robot in cleaning the house in a planned manner and avoids areas that have been missed. The app allows you to create "no go zones" so that the robot will not clean areas such as playgrounds for kids or dog beds.

Once the robot has laid the layout of your home, it's ready to start working. As it systematically moves across the floors, its main brush picks dust and dirt while side brushes sweep away debris from corners and edges. Some of our top-performing models even feature a rotating mopping pad that can deal with spills and dried-on food residue.

Robotic vacuums are easier to maintained than full-size vacuums, however, you must still perform regular maintenance to ensure they will last for as long as possible. This means emptying the trash bin after each cleaning session and getting rid of any hairs that are tangled from the brushes (especially on models with tangle-prone bristle brushes) to ensure that they don't block the mechanism. You should also wipe down the robot's docking station and batteries occasionally to remove built-up dirt from both surfaces.

4. It's eco-friendly

In addition to making the job easier Robot vacuum cleaners also consume less energy than traditional models and can help you save money on your electricity bill. This reduced energy consumption is due to the sophisticated technology used in these robot vacuum ebay cleaning machines.

This technology includes sensors and cameras that allow them to navigate with precision. LiDAR-based systems for instance utilize lasers to scan the surrounding and map rooms, which ensures maximum efficiency. Camera-based systems use built-in optical cameras to form an image map, but this can be difficult in dim lighting. Sensor-based systems are suitable for most homes, but can not reach places that are difficult to reach and require more energy. Other features that help reduce the environmental impact of these robots are the cliff sensors that keep them from falling down stairs and large-area maps that allow them to clean up more of your space in one cleaning session.

5. You can afford it

If you're not planning to spend a lot of money on the top-of-the-line robot vacuum cleaner, there are a variety of budget-friendly options. However, it's important to be aware of what you're getting for your money. Cheaper robots tend to have lower warranties and less dependable customer service. This could result in the robot being more likely to fail and require expensive repairs or replacements.

cheap robot vacuum robots are also less likely to have the same level of intelligence built in that helps them navigate around the house. While there's been advancement in the field of mapping and obstacle avoidance technology, it's still not foolproof. Because of this, some models are prone to being tripped by socks and slippers as well as power cords and hair from pets - even if you've taken the time to "robot-proof" your home.

Budget robots also have smaller bins that must be cleaned frequently. This is true, especially when you have pets who shed fur and leave a trail of fur on your floors.

Budget robots can also have difficulty cleaning dusty carpets and baseboards. They might also not be as efficient as more expensive models. If you have shag-pile carpets that are extremely thick, the robot could get stuck and stop cleaning.
